OPPO is a Chinese electronics manufacturer that has been making waves in the smartphone industry for the past few years. One of their latest devices, the OPPO Reno4, has garnered a lot of attention for its sleek design and impressive features. In this blog post, we’ll take a closer look at the OPPO Reno4 and what it has to offer.

OPPO RENO4 DETAILS

The OPPO Reno4 boasts a sleek and modern design with a 6.43-inch AMOLED display and a resolution of 1080 x 2400 pixels. The display is crisp and clear, with vibrant colors and excellent viewing angles. The phone has a hole-punch cutout for the front-facing camera, which gives it a modern and futuristic look.

The Reno4 has a slim and lightweight body, weighing in at just 165g, making it comfortable to hold and easy to carry around. The back of the phone has a glossy finish, and it’s available in three colors: Galactic Blue, Space Black, and Space White.

One of the standout features of the OPPO Reno4 is its camera setup. It has a triple camera system on the back, including a 48MP main camera, an 8MP ultrawide camera, and a 2MP macro camera. The front-facing camera is a 32MP sensor and a 2MP Depth Camera, which is great for taking selfies and video calls.

The camera system on the Reno4 is impressive, with excellent image quality and a range of features and settings to help you capture the perfect shot. It has a variety of shooting modes, including Night Mode, which helps you take clear and bright photos in low-light conditions.

Under the hood, the OPPO Reno4 is powered by a Qualcomm Snapdragon 765G processor and 8GB of RAM, which provides smooth and snappy performance. It also has 128GB of internal storage, which should be more than enough for most users.

The Reno4 has a 4015mAh battery, which provides all-day battery life with normal usage. It also supports fast charging, so you can quickly top up the battery when you need to.

The OPPO Reno4 runs on the ColorOS, which is based on Android 10. The user interface is clean and intuitive, with a variety of customization options to help you make the phone your own. The phone also comes with a range of pre-installed apps, including popular social media and entertainment apps.

Verdict

Overall, the OPPO Reno4 5G is an impressive device that offers a sleek design, an excellent camera system, and snappy performance. It’s a great choice for anyone looking for a mid-range smartphone with high-end features. If you’re in the market for a new phone, the OPPO Reno4 is definitely worth considering.
